Tasks
-Introducing new residents and their families to the community’s life enrichment programs -Assisting in coordinating holiday decoration displays for the community -Participate in ongoing company required trainings and certifications -Driving community bus for outings and appointments as needed -Assisting in planning, scheduling and leading community activities programs, holiday celebrations and special events -Assisting in taking activity attendance and completing family messaging in our electronic platform -Contributing to resident assessments by assisting in completing or ensuring completion of Life Stories -Attend monthly virtual education meetings provided by Home Office Support

What You Bring
-Ability to work well with others, communicate clearly and take direction from management, as well as to take initiative and go above and beyond to meet resident needs -Ability to meet all physical demands of the position which includes, but is not limited to, seeing, speaking, touching, walking, standing, bending, reaching overhead, crouching/kneeling or crawling, as well as the ability to regularly lift/move up to 50lbs independently and up to 100lbs with assistance -Cedar Creek of Prairie Meadows considers the health and safety of its residents, family members, and team members as its highest priorities. All offers of employment are conditioned on completing and passing a background and drug test, participating in mandatory COVID-19 vaccine program, participating in testing requirements (COVID-19 and TB) and using designated PPE when required. -Flexibility and the ability to work weekends and holidays on a regular rotation as well as some occasional evenings for special events -Working knowledge of computer applications such as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, Outlook, etc.) -License to drive community bus or ability to obtain license within 30 days of employment -Possess a genuine passion and interest in caring for seniors and individuals living with dementia

The Company
About Cedarhurst Senior Living
-Delivers a spectrum of living options—from independent apartments to memory care neighborhoods—rooted in person‑centered support. -Developed standout programs like Dream Come TRUE (granting resident bucket‑list experiences) and Pair to Prepare™ to ease transitions. -Invests in memory‑care training and evidence‑based programming, earning certifications and Alzheimer’s Association recognition. -Typical communities feature chef‑prepared dining, fitness and wellness offerings, walking paths, communal spaces, and regular excursions.
